| Abstract | Poorly maintained roads are a fact of life in most developing countries; it is certainly the case in Sri Lanka. The lack of funding to maintain the road surfaces is a main reason for the dilapidated condition of roads in these countries, but i t is not the only reason. The absence of an effective monitoring system is one reason for this problem. A monitoring system can help to take remedial actions and that can lower the cost of maintenance. However, the cost of an effective monitoring system itself can be quite costly and hardy affordable fo r a developing country. We are developing a road surface condition monitoring system that uses acceleration sensors mounted on public transport buses to monitor the road surface condition with only a few sensors. These bus mounted sensors gather vertical and horizontal acceleration data on its route togethe r with the GPS coordinates of the data collection points. This road surface condition monitoring system is in fact piggy backed on an environmental pollution monitoring system called BusNet that uses the sensors mounted on the public transport buses to collect data on environmental pollution . In this paper we present a technique that we developed to identify ”potholes” on roads by analyzing the acceleration data. |
